Speed Limit Restored on Interstates in the Northwest Region

The Pennsylvania Department of Transportation (PennDOT) has lifted the temporary speed limit restrictions on all interstates in the northwest region.

Due to the severity of the winter weather impacting the region this morning, speed limits were temporarily reduced to 45 mph.

All speeds are now restored to their usual posted limits in the northwest region.

Motorists can check conditions on major roadways by visiting www.511PA.com. 511PA, which is free and available 24 hours a day, provides traffic delay warnings, weather forecasts, traffic speed information and access to more than 1,000 traffic cameras.

511PA is also available through a smartphone application for iPhone and Android devices, by calling 5-1-1, or by following regional Twitter alerts accessible on the 511PA website.
